How To Link A Contact With A Deal

Keeping track of your deals is an important aspect of your business process. When you convert a "Lead" to a "Deal", Distributed Source automatically adds the associated contact with the deal so you know which contacts are to be dealt with.

Sometimes, you may want to associate additional contacts with a deal.  This article explains how to link a contact with a deal:

1. Login to your Distributed Source account.

2. Go to the 'Contacts' tab. All the contacts which are a part of your account will be displayed here.





3. Click on the contact whom you want to link to a deal.





4. In the rightmost frame, click on the 'Deals' tab.






6. Now you need to decide if you want to link the contact with an existing deal or whether you want to create a new deal and associate the chosen contact with it. If you want to link the contact with an existing deal, continue to step 7. Else, skip to step 8.

7. If you decided on associating the contact with an existing deal, 

  • Click on the '+Existing' button.






  • Type in the first few initials of the deal name in the text box.





  • All the deals which are similar will be displayed in a drop-down menu.




D) Select the deal to be linked with this contact and click on the '+Add' button.





E) The deal will now be successfully linked to the chosen contact.





9. If you have decided on associating the contact with a new deal, follow these steps:

F) Click on the '+New' button.




G) A pop-up titled 'Create New Deal' will be displayed on your screen




H) Add the deal details (name and notes) in the respective fields.




I) Once done, click on the 'Create This Deal' button. 



J) The new deal's details will now be successfully saved and your contact will be linked to this deal.
